Sterling Holiday Resorts, a leading Indian leisure hospitality brand, has announced a new program to develop its future leaders. The Emerging Leader’s Development Program (ELDP) is a collaboration with the Indian School of Hospitality (ISH), a premier hospitality education institute.
This 12-month program aims to equip Sterling’s employees with the skills needed to drive future growth. A key element is a 4-month immersive program at ISH, focusing on areas like marketing, leadership, finance and digital strategies in a hospitality context, including the growing role of AI.
“The Emerging Leaders Development Program is a testament to ISH’s commitment to empower the future leaders of the hospitality industry and drive positive change and excellence in the segment. The initiative will deliver comprehensive training and promote critical thinking, leadership skills and innovation to ensure that the participants excel in their roles as General Managers,” said Dilip Puri, Founder & Executive Chairman, Indian School of Hospitality.
This partnership leverages ISH’s expertise and global network, which is part of Sommet Education.
